Bitcoin May Rebound 21% This Week as October Tendencies Favor Restoration, Economist Says

Bitcoin could also be primed for a pointy rebound after final week’s steep sell-off, in response to economist Timothy Peterson, who believes the world’s largest cryptocurrency may climb as a lot as 21% within the subsequent seven days if October’s historic patterns maintain.

Key Takeaways:

  • Economist Timothy Peterson predicts Bitcoin may rebound as much as 21% this week.
  • Since 2013, October has averaged 20.1% positive aspects, making it Bitcoin’s second-best month behind November.
  • Regardless of a short plunge to $102,000 after Trump’s tariff announcement, analysts stay bullish.

“Drops of greater than 5% in October are exceedingly uncommon,” Peterson wrote on X Friday, noting it has solely occurred 4 occasions up to now decade, in 2017, 2018, 2019, and 2021.

In three of these years, Bitcoin rallied instantly afterward, gaining 16%, 4%, and 21%, respectively, whereas solely 2021 noticed a minor decline of three%.

October Lives As much as ‘Uptober’ Hype as Bitcoin’s Second-Greatest Month on File

October’s fame as “Uptober” continues to strengthen. Since 2013, it has been Bitcoin’s second-best performing month, delivering a median return of 20.1%, behind solely November’s 46% common.

Peterson’s feedback adopted a dramatic market correction on Friday when Bitcoin briefly dipped beneath $102,000 after US President Donald Trump confirmed plans for a 100% tariff on Chinese language imports.

The market has since stabilized, with Bitcoin buying and selling close to $111,700, recovering from an earlier excessive of $125,100 set on Monday, in response to CoinMarketCap.

If Bitcoin mirrors its strongest October rebound, the 21% surge seen in 2019, an analogous transfer from Friday’s low would push the worth again to round $124,000, simply shy of its latest report.

Regardless of final week’s turbulence, many Bitcoin advocates stay bullish. Samson Mow, founding father of Jan3, reminded merchants that “there are nonetheless 21 days left in Uptober.”

In the meantime, Michael van de Poppe, founding father of MN Buying and selling Capital, referred to as the newest dip “the underside of the present cycle.”

Others have taken a broader view. The Bitcoin Libertarian argued that huge liquidation occasions are a part of the asset’s pure evolution, predicting that even when Bitcoin trades close to $1 million, comparable volatility will persist.

Analyst Warns Bitcoin Faces Decisive 100-Day Window

Bitcoin could also be nearing a crucial turning level, in response to dealer Tony “The Bull” Severino, who believes the subsequent 100 days may decide whether or not the cryptocurrency enters a parabolic rally or ends its present bull cycle.

Severino pointed to the Bollinger Bands indicator on Bitcoin’s weekly chart, which has tightened to ranges unseen earlier than, typically a precursor to sharp value strikes in both path.

Severino cautioned that “head fakes,” or false breakouts, are widespread throughout such setups. He famous Bitcoin just lately failed to interrupt above the higher band with energy after briefly touching $126,000, suggesting a possible dip earlier than any sustained rally.

Presently, BTC trades round $122,700, hovering beneath its report highs as volatility compresses additional.

Whereas some analysts worry a looming breakdown, others argue that Bitcoin’s cycles are getting longer, hinting at extra room for progress.
